[QUOTE="FEENIX, post: 2279755, member: 14204"] "If" you have 75 MOA total elevation, you have 37.5 MOA of up/down adjustment do when done correctly, you would have ~57.5 MOA of up elevation when zeroed with 20 MOA cant. Read up on your zero stop adjustment and re-zero. ADDED: Not the best video but it gets the point across ... [MEDIA=youtube]IKsT5vic9ZQ:146[/MEDIA] [/QUOTE]
